LF Intrusion Detection is an open source intrusion detection system for Linux servers. It monitors network traffic and system logs for suspicious activity and alerts administrators when potential attacks or policy violations are detected.
win2ban is an open-source intrusion detection and automated banning software for Linux-based servers. It monitors log files for signs of malicious activity and blocks repeat offenders via firewall rules.
